Going on a 10 Day trip in July with my family of 4 (kids ages 6 & 8).

We are planning to spend a day on our upcoming trip in a waterpark. This day will be near the end of our trip and I'm looking to get some plans for the evening. I think we might be too tired to go hit up another theme park. We already have time set aside for Disney Springs and am looking for some alternate plans. Originally I was looking to do Dinner at Ohana or Artist Point but there are no times available that work for us. I saw that there is an opening at Sanaa for a later dinner (7:50pm)

How does an evening like this sound? Arrive at AKL at 6:30 and then dinner at Sanaa at 7:50. Would this be enjoyable for kids. Is there enough to see/do?

Sanaa is delicious. If your kids like animals, there are many to see. If it's already dark, there are night-vision goggles you can use. Keep in mind that Sanaa is at Kidani Village, which is a short walk or bus ride from the proper Animal Kingdom Lodge. AKL and Kidani are both beautiful, but Kidani's lobby is quite a bit smaller and not as grand.

But you can also keep checking for your top choices.

AKL is a great way to spend some nonpark time! Not just for the animals, but also the unique decor of the resort. Sanaa is a good dinner choice, but I would worry that if it's too dark, it dampens the allure of dining and seeing the animals. Any opening for Boma?
